The Birth of AWS
Amazon Web Services (AWS) was launched in 2006 by Amazon.com with the goal of providing businesses with scalable and cost-effective IT infrastructure solutions. Amazon created a cloud infrastructure capable of supporting any workload by leveraging its vast experience managing a massive e-commerce platform. The initial focus was on providing storage, computation, and database services, which laid the groundwork for AWS to become the leading cloud computing platform.
